How to handle business logic errors and application exceptions from business logic layer in MVC ASP.NET - asp.net-mvc

I'm working on an ASP.NET MVC application in which I need to trap errors in business logic classes and redirect to error controller. I need to trap both errors, ones which are related to my business logic and others which are application exceptions. If I throw an exception from my business logic, how do I catch that in the current controller and how do I redirect to ErrorController?

You can decorate your Controller/Action with the [HandleErrorAttribute] to do just that.
For example:
[HandleError]
public ActionResult PlaceOrder(OrderDetails orderDetails)
{
orderService.PlaceOrder(orderDetails);
return View("Success");
}
You can set the appropriate View to load to depend on the Exception Type:
[HandleError(ExceptionType=typeof(PlaceOrderException),View="OrdersError"]
[HandleError(ExceptionType=typeof(Exception),View="GeneralError"]
public ActionResult PlaceOrder(OrderDetails orderDetails)
{
orderService.PlaceOrder(orderDetails);
return View("Success");
}
Alternatively, you can register it globally on your global.asax:
GlobalFilters.Filters.Add(new HandleErrorAttribute
{
View = "Error"
});
P.S: The above example assumes your 'Error/GeneralError/OrdersError' Views are in the Shared folder. if they're not, you're gonna need to specify the full path.
Edit (as per your comment):
If you want to return Json instead of View, create the following ActionFilter:
public class HandleErrorJsonAttribute : FilterAttribute, IExceptionFilter
{
public void OnException(ExceptionContext filterContext)
{
filterContext.ExceptionHandled = true;
filterContext.HttpContext.Response.Clear();
filterContext.HttpContext.Response.StatusCode = 500;
filterContext.HttpContext.Response.TrySkipIisCustomErrors = true;
filterContext.Result = new JsonResult
{
JsonRequestBehavior = JsonRequestBehavior.AllowGet,
ContentType = "application/json",
Data = new
{
Msg = "An Error Occured",
ExceptionMsg = filterContext.Exception.ToString()
}
};
}
}
Then use the new [HandleErrorJson] attribute (as outlined above), or register it as a Global Filter in your global.asax.

I think you are confused about AuthorizeAttribute. It is an Action Filter, not a Data Annotation. Data Annotations decorate model properties for validatioj, Action Filter's decorate controller actions to examine the controller's context and doing something before the action executes.
So, restricting access to a controller action is the raison d'etre of the AuthorizeAttribute, so let's use it!
With the help of the good folks of SO, I created a customer Action Filter that restricted access to actions (and even controllers) based on being part of an Access Directory group:
public class AuthorizeADAttribute : AuthorizeAttribute
{
public string Groups { get; set; }
protected override bool AuthorizeCore(HttpContextBase httpContext)
{
if (base.AuthorizeCore(httpContext))
{
/* Return true immediately if the authorization is not
locked down to any particular AD group */
if (String.IsNullOrEmpty(Groups))
return true;
// Get the AD groups
var groups = Groups.Split(',').ToList<string>();
// Verify that the user is in the given AD group (if any)
var context = new PrincipalContext(ContextType.Domain, "YOURADCONTROLLER");
var userPrincipal = UserPrincipal.FindByIdentity(context,
IdentityType.SamAccountName,
httpContext.User.Identity.Name);
foreach (var group in groups)
{
try
{
if (userPrincipal.IsMemberOf(context, IdentityType.Name, group))
return true;
}
catch (NoMatchingPrincipalException exc)
{
var msg = String.Format("While authenticating a user, the operation failed due to the group {0} could not be found in Active Directory.", group);
System.ApplicationException e = new System.ApplicationException(msg, exc);
ErrorSignal.FromCurrentContext().Raise(e);
return false;
}
catch (Exception exc)
{
var msg = "While authenticating a user, the operation failed.";
System.ApplicationException e = new System.ApplicationException(msg, exc);
ErrorSignal.FromCurrentContext().Raise(e);
return false;
}
}
}
return false;
}
}
Note this will return a 401 Unauthorized, which makes sense, and not the 404 Not Found you indicated above.
Now, the magic in this is you can restrict access by applying it at the action level:
[AuthorizeAD(Groups = "Editor,Contributer")]
public ActionResult Create()
Or at the controller level:
[AuthorizeAD(Groups = "Admin")]
public class AdminController : Controller
Or even globally by editing FilterConfig.cs in `/App_Start':
public class FilterConfig
{
public static void RegisterGlobalFilters(GlobalFilterCollection filters)
{
filters.Add(new HandleErrorAttribute());
filters.Add(new Code.Filters.MVC.AuthorizeADAttribute() { Groups = "User, Editor, Contributor, Admin" });
}
Complete awesome sauce!
P.S. You mention page lifecycle in your second point. There is no such thing in MVC, at least not in the Web Forms sense you might be thinking. That's a good thing to my mind, as things are greatly simplified, and I don't have to remember a dozen or so different lifecycle events and what the heck each one of them is raised for!

HandleError is designed to be able to register multiple filters (for example for different exceptions). One filter can handle only some specific exceptions or error cases and another unhandle cases can be handled by another HandleError. I suppose that currently both standard and your [CustomHandleError] filter are applied. You can set the Order property to an integer value that specifies a priority from -1 (highest priority) to any positive integer value. The greater the integer value is, the lower the priority of the filter is. You can use Order parameter for example (see here) to make your filter working before. More full description of the order you can find in the MSDN documentation.
The answer, this one and the article for example provide small examples of usage Order property of HandleError.

I am going little off topic. I thought this is bit important to explain.
If you pay attention to the above highlighted part. I have specified the order of the Action Filter. This basically describes the order of execution of Action Filter. This is a situation when you have multiple Action Filters implemented over Controller/Action Method
This picture just indicates that let's say you have two Action Filters. OnActionExecution will start to execute on Priority and OnActionExecuted will start from bottom to Top. That means in case of OnActionExecuted Action Filter having highest order will execute first and in case of OnActionExecuting Action Filter having lowest order will execute first. Example below.
public class Filter1 : ActionFilterAttribute
{
public override void OnActionExecuting(ActionExecutingContext filterContext)
{
//Execution will start here - 1
base.OnActionExecuting(filterContext);
}
public override void OnActionExecuted(ActionExecutedContext filterContext)
{
//Execution will move here - 5
base.OnActionExecuted(filterContext);
}
}
public class Filter2 : ActionFilterAttribute
{
public override void OnActionExecuting(ActionExecutingContext filterContext)
{
//Execution will move here - 2
base.OnActionExecuting(filterContext);
}
public override void OnActionExecuted(ActionExecutedContext filterContext)
{
//Execution will move here - 4
base.OnActionExecuted(filterContext);
}
}
[HandleError]
public class HomeController : Controller
{
[Filter1(Order = 1)]
[Filter2(Order = 2)]
public ActionResult Index()
{
//Execution will move here - 3
ViewData["Message"] = "Welcome to ASP.NET MVC!";
return View();
}
}
You may already aware that there are different types of filters within MVC framework. They are listed below.
Authorization filters
Action filters
Response/Result filters
Exception filters
Within each filter, you can specify the Order property. This basically describes the order of execution of the Action Filters.
Use TempData for getting value.
Some feature about TempData
TempData is a dictionary object that is derived from TempDataDictionary class and stored in short lives session.
TempData is used to pass data from current request to subsequent request means incase of redirection.
It’s life is very short and lies only till the target view is fully loaded.
It’s required typecasting for complex data type and check for null values to avoid error.
It is used to store only one time messages like error messages, validation messages.

MVC HandleError vs customErrors tag

So if I understand [HandleError] correctly (see here) you have to add it to each Controller that you want to have errors handled on.
It seems much easier to just add the path of your error page into the web.config customErrors tag:
<customErrors mode="On" defaultRedirect="~/Error/Index" >
</customErrors>
In what situations would using [HandleError] be better than that?
In [HandleError] you can achieve quite a lot. You can log the error. You can also figure out the kind of error and based on situation you can redirect the user to certain page.Following is one sample -
public class HandleErrorAttribute : FilterAttribute, IExceptionFilter
{
public void OnException(ExceptionContext filterContext)
{
if (filterContext.ExceptionHandled)
return;
string referrerController = string.Empty;
string referrerAction = string.Empty;
if (filterContext.HttpContext.Request.UrlReferrer != null)
{
string[] segments = filterContext.HttpContext.Request.UrlReferrer.Segments;
if (segments.Length > 1)
{
referrerController = segments[1] != null ? segments[1].Replace("/", string.Empty) : string.Empty;
}
if (segments.Length > 2)
{
referrerAction = segments[2] != null ? segments[2].Replace("/", string.Empty) : string.Empty;
}
}
filterContext.Controller.TempData["exception"] = filterContext.Exception.Message;
filterContext.Result = new RedirectToRouteResult(new RouteValueDictionary(
new { controller = referrerController , action = referrerAction}));
filterContext.ExceptionHandled = true;
filterContext.HttpContext.Response.Clear();
}
}
In this code I am saving exception message to TempData, so that I can show the error message to user. This is just one example but you can do anything that your requirements demand. Here I am creating my own [HandleError] attribute by inheriting from FilterAttribute and implementing IExceptionFilter. You can see the kind of power I am getting here. I implemented my own attribute to handle my requirements. But you can achieve the similar results by using built in [HandleError].
Purpose of line no. 2 is to handle a scenario where somebody else in chain has already handled the exception. Then in that case you might not be interested to handle it again. Response.Clear() is to clear the pipe before I redirect user to new page. It is not necessary to be there in your case.
Any attribute can applied to all controllers globally in FilterConfig.RegisterGlobalFilters:
filters.Add(new HandleErrorAttribute());
Can be done for API controllers too in the relevant method, i.e. WebApiConfig.Register.
However, if you only need to display a simple error page just use customErrors.
